Stephen J. Pyne
Stephen J. Pyne (born 1949) is an emeritus professor at Arizona State University, specializing in environmental history, the history of exploration, and especially the history of fire. Education Pyne received his bachelor's degree at Stanford University after graduating from Brophy College Preparatory, a Jesuit high school, in Phoenix, Arizona. He later attained his master's (1974) and Ph.D. degrees (1976) at the University of Texas at Austin, receiving a MacArthur Fellowship in 1988. He also received a summer Fulbright Fellowship to Sweden, was awarded two National Endowment for the Humanities Fellowships, and had two tours at the National Humanities Center. He was a professor at Arizona State University from 1985 to 2018. Pyne spent fifteen seasons as a wildland firefighter at the North Rim of Grand Canyon National Park between 1967 and 1981, twelve as crew boss. Nuclear Weapons Testing
Nuclear weapons tests are experiments carried out to determine the performance of nuclear weapons and the effects of Nuclear explosion, their explosion. Nuclear testing is a sensitive political issue. Governments have often performed tests to signal strength. Because of their destruction and fallout, testing has seen opposition by civilians as well as governments, with international bans having been agreed on. Thousands of tests have been performed, with most in the second half of the 20th century. The first nuclear device was detonated as a test by the United States at the Trinity site in New Mexico on July 16, 1945, with a yield approximately TNT equivalent, equivalent to 20 kilotons of TNT. The first thermonuclear weapon technology test of an engineered device, codenamed Ivy Mike, was tested at the Enewetak Atoll in the Marshall Islands on November 1, 1952 (local date), also by the United States. Biodiversity Loss
Biodiversity loss happens when plant or animal species disappear completely from Earth (extinction) or when there is a decrease or disappearance of species in a specific area. Biodiversity loss means that there is a reduction in Biodiversity, biological diversity in a given area. The decrease can be temporary or permanent. It is temporary if the damage that led to the loss is reversible in time, for example through ecological restoration. If this is not possible, then the decrease is permanent. The cause of most of the biodiversity loss is, generally speaking, human activities that push the planetary boundaries too far. These activities include habitat destruction (for example deforestation) and land use intensification (for example monoculture farming). Further problem areas are Air pollution, air and water pollution (including nutrient pollution), over-exploitation, Invasive alien species, invasive species and climate change. Pyrocene
Pyrocene is a proposed term for a new Geologic time scale, geologic epoch or age characterized by the influence of human-caused fire activity on Earth. The concept focuses on the many ways humans have applied and removed fire from the Earth, including the burning of fossil fuels and the technologies that have enabled people to leverage their influence and become the dominant species on the planet. The Pyrocene offers a fire-centric perspective on human history that is an alternative to or complementary term for the Anthropocene. Like the Anthropocene, the concept suggests that human activity has shaped the Earth's geology and identifies fire as humanity's primary tool for shaping the planet and its environment. Pyrocene was first proposed by environmental historian Stephen J. Pyne in 2015. Anthropocene
''Anthropocene'' is a term that has been used to refer to the period of time during which human impact on the environment, humanity has become a planetary force of change. It appears in scientific and social discourse, especially with respect to accelerating geophysical and biochemical changes that characterize the 20th and 21st centuries on Earth. Originally a proposal for a new geological epoch following the Holocene, it was rejected as such in 2024 by the International Commission on Stratigraphy (ICS) and the International Union of Geological Sciences (IUGS). The term has been used in research relating to Earth's Ocean, water, geology, geomorphology, landscape, limnology, hydrology, ecosystems and climate. The effects of human activities on Earth can be seen, for example, in regards to biodiversity loss, and climate change.
